Datadog's EMEA GTM Strategy & Operations team is responsible for both strategic planning and daytoday operational excellence across the region. The team uncovers, analyzes, and prioritizes improvement opportunities that drive incremental revenue and operational efficiency. We build business cases for EMEA investment, optimize resources during annual planning, and collaborate closely with global teams to enhance systems, tools, programs, and processes. We also lead the execution of global initiatives within EMEA and share best practices across regions to accelerate global scale.

As part of the EMEA GTM Strategy & Operations team, you'll work with sales leaders and global partners to improve how we plan, execute, and automate core GTM processes across the region. You'll be AInative in how you work, using modern AI tools to get to insight faster, diagnose root causes, and free your time for driving change and partnering with the business.

What You'll Do

  • Build strong relationships with local, regional, and global crossfunctional stakeholders to enhance GTM strategy and operations for EMEA, sharing learnings and best practices across markets.
  • Localize and execute global GTM policies and sales programs (for example: pipeline generation programs, product plays, territory deep dives), ensuring they are adapted effectively to EMEA market realities.
  • Act as a primary point of contact for a defined set of sales leaders on strategic and operational questions (e.g. account coverage, rules of engagement, data led operating cadence, QBR inputs etc..).
  • Orchestrate and support the rhythm of business, including data preparation and standardization for Quarterly Business Reviews (QBRs), forecast/LQSR cadences, and annual planning cycles.
  • Partner with systems, data, and central operations teams to simplify and automate recurring work (for example: standard QBR/LQSR kits, selfserve lists and dashboards, queue and SLA reporting), using AIenabled workflows where it meaningfully reduces manual effort.
  • Produce analyses, reports, and recommendations on sales performance, coverage, pipeline, and program effectiveness, leveraging AI tools to explore data faster, spot patterns, and get to root causes so you can focus more time on driving action with stakeholders.
  • Manage crossfunctional projects from initiation to completion,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ives, clear timelines, and welldefined success metrics.
  • Document processes, definitions, and best practices so that outputs are scalable, repeatable, and easy for sales leaders and partner teams to adopt.

Who You Are

  • 2-4+ years of experience in GTM Strategy & Operations, management consulting, banking, analytics, or a similar analytical field, ideally within SaaS or highgrowth B2B technology.
  • Experience working with gotomarket teams (e.g. Sales, CS, Marketing) and comfort acting as a trusted advisor to commercial leadership.
  • Strong analytical skills and ability to translate data into clear insights and practical recommendations that improve business performance.
  • Comfort using modern AI tools as part of your daytoday workflow (for example, to accelerate analysis, draft and refine narratives, or prototype simple automations), and curiosity to experiment with new capabilities.
  • Familiarity with Salesforce and BI tools (e.g. Tableau, Metabase, or similar); experience with SQL or a willingness to learn on the job.
  • High att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and the ability to manage multiple priorities and stakeholders in a fastmoving environment.
  • Comfortable operating in ambiguity and shifting between bigpicture strategic thinking and handson execution.
  • Effective verbal and written communicator who can build alignment and influence crossfunctional partners.
